Output 308e66c15af85bfafbf82efce3ee68a03116c561b277b54cc7ebe0ad194c6f63:9

value
509000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4bb60e8b66bdf753b05462f4ecacf996c11fab2 OP_EQUAL
address
3NYSTa5GS8EhtVAbrwPuwyBZmeYtfPJ2EH
transaction
308e66c15af85bfafbf82efce3ee68a03116c561b277b54cc7ebe0ad194c6f63
spent
true